#bb12e0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b12e0 is composed of 73.3% red, 7.1%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.5% cyan, 92%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 289.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 47.5%. #bb12e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ff24ff with #7700c1.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#bb12e0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bb12e0 has RGB values of R:187, G:18,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 12260064.

Shades and Tints of #bb12e0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050006 is the darkest color, while #fcf3fe is the lightest one.
